Strategic Resources ( (TSE:SR) ) has shared an update.
Strategic Resources has expanded its board and management team by appointing vanadium industry veteran Terry Perles as a director and Business Development Lead for vanadium and titanium products. Perles, who brings extensive experience from leading roles in the vanadium and titanium sectors and industry associations, will focus on securing joint ventures and collaboration agreements, representing the company at key industry events, supporting investor relations, and providing market intelligence, moves that management believes will strengthen Strategic’s ability to advance its BlackRock Project and capitalize on growing global demand for critical minerals. As part of his compensation, Perles has been granted 100,000 stock options with a multi‑year vesting schedule, further aligning his interests with long‑term shareholder value.
More about Strategic Resources
Strategic Resources Inc. is a Montreal-based critical mineral development company focused on vanadium, high‑purity iron and titanium, key metals for the energy transition and decarbonization of the global economy. Its main assets include the construction-ready BlackRock Project in Quebec, which plans a 4‑million‑tonne‑per‑year high‑purity iron ore pellet plant at Port Saguenay with seaway access, and the previously operated Mustavaara mine in Finland.
